Datasheet information:
Optimal tasting: 2008-2020 (This will live longer)
Grape varieties: 55% Cabernet Sauvignon; 40% Merlot; 5% Petit Verdot
Pruning: Double Guyot system for Cabernet Sauvignon, Cordon system for Merlot and Petit Verdot
Ageing: 18 months in French oak barrel - New barrels: 40%
The dry and cool winter was followed by warm weather in June, allowing a late but optimal blossoming. This resulted in an abundant crop, despite important green harvest in July. The lack of sunshine during the summer confirmed this delay, which was compensated by an exceptional fine weather in September and October. Warm days and cool nights helped the slow ripening of the grapes. The harvest took place in the best conditions, with the picking of the different grape varieties at the top of their maturity. A beautiful Indian summer allowed us to obtain a great elegance from the Cabernet Sauvignon.
